Umrah program participants depart Madinah for Makkah under ministry guidance

Madinah, February 5, 2024, Participants in the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ques Program for Umrah and Visit, overseen by the Ministry of Islamic Affairs, Dawah, and Guidance, departed from Madinah today and headed to Makkah to partake in the sacred rituals of Umrah.

Expressing their sincere appreciation, the guests conveyed gratitude to the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ques, King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al-Saud, and His Royal Highness Prince Mohammed bin Salman bin Abdulaziz Al-Saud, the Crown Prince and Prime Minister. They extended their thanks for the opportunity to be hosted and to perform Umrah, a pilgrimage of great significance in Islam, symbolizing spiritual purification and connection with the divine.
